Аннотация

Results of investigation of lasing of epoxy polymer compositions with phenalemine 512 and ZnO nanoparticles are given. It is shown that incorporation of ZnO nanoparticles affects the lasing efficiency without reducing the operating lifetime. The material is promising for the development of laser-active media.
